Missouri Law Is Not Simple
Every state has its own laws. Missouri has rules that could hurt your case.
Some things to know:
- You have five years to file most injury claims.
- If you miss that deadline, you may get nothing.
- If you are partly at fault, your payment gets reduced.
- The clock starts ticking the day of the crash.

What to Do Right After a Crash
Here’s what to do if you’re in a crash in Kansas City:
- Call 911. Always report the crash.
- Get checked by a doctor. Even if you feel fine.
- Take photos. Show the cars, street, signs, and injuries.
- Swap info. Get names, phone numbers, plates, and insurance.
- Stay quiet. Don’t say “sorry” or guess what happened.
- Talk to a lawyer. The sooner, the better.

FAQs About Kansas City Car Accidents
- How much does a personal injury lawyer cost?
Nothing upfront. They get paid from your final settlement if you win. - How long do I have to file a claim?
In Missouri, the deadline is five years from the crash date. - What if I was partly at fault?
You can still get money. The amount may be less based on your share of fault. - What if I don’t feel hurt right away?
Still see a doctor. Some injuries show up later. Medical records help your case. - What if the other driver has no insurance?
You may still recover money through your own insurance or other legal options.
